What is the average cost of building a 2 story extension to an existing house?
Answers:
Measure the area you want to build i.e length X Width if a rectangle now multiply that by around £1200 to £1500 per square metre of extra floor space, the further south you live the further up the pricing scale you are likely to be. I am currently trying to get a single storey L shaped extension on my side and rear and the quotes I have had for that vary from £27322+vat all included to £45000 just for the shell to be erected so make sure you get a few quotes and ALWAYS inspect their previous worksmanship and go back after the builder has left you to try and speak to the owner in case they are trying to pull a fast one. Don't forget aswell other fees are incurred such as architects, surveyors(if Party Wall Act 1996 comes into play), planning fees and solicitors(you may need to get your deeds changed.
